Join us for our virtual English Fiction Book Club meeting. We will discuss The Light Between Oceans, by M. L. Stedman. The novel tells of a World War I veteran and his new wife who face loss and emotional hardship while living on a remote island. Copies of the book will be available at the User Services Desk. Sensory Processing Disorder is a condition that may affect children who have neurodevelopmental disorders such as ADHD and autism, as well as those with learning and processing challenges. If your child struggles with similar issues, join us in this session and learn how to assist your child with sensory integration exercises that can be done at home. The session will be presented by Bassam Adel Hamad, Occupational Therapist at the Qatar Foundation Learning Center.

The idea of the workshop is to transform a soft drink can into a camera that takes vintage photos that reflect the spirit of photography in the 18th century. With this camera, you can experience the early days of photography, learn how cameras work, what they are made of, how they are manufactured and how to capture memorable photos.
